  • Patent number: 9573595
    Abstract: A method for operating a speed control system of a vehicle is provided. The method comprises detecting an occurrence of a slip event, of a step encounter event, or of both events at a leading wheel of the vehicle. The method also comprises predicting that the occurrence of the detected event(s) will occur at a following wheel of the vehicle. The method yet further comprises automatically controlling vehicle speed, vehicle acceleration, or both vehicle speed and acceleration in response to the detection, the prediction, or both the detection and prediction. A speed control system comprising an electronic control unit (ECU) configured to perform the above-described methodology is also provided.

  • Publication number: 20170043778
    Abstract: A method of operating an automatic speed control system of a vehicle in accordance with a set-speed. The method comprises receiving electrical signal(s) representative of a vehicle occupant-initiated brake command to slow the vehicle to a stop, and in response, suspending automatic speed control in accordance with said set-speed and commanding the application of a retarding torque to one or more wheels of the vehicle to bring the vehicle to a stop, while maintaining the speed control system in an active state. The method further comprises receiving electrical signal(s) representative of a vehicle occupant-initiated brake release command, and in response, and while maintaining the speed control system in an active state, automatically commanding the generation of drive torque sufficient to propel the vehicle in an intended direction and automatically controlling the speed of the vehicle in accordance with said set-speed.

  • Patent number: 9511769
    Abstract: Autonomous cruise control is provided to permit one vehicle to follow another at a predetermined separation regardless of gradient. A system and method is disclosed which continually determines the separation distance of the vehicles, the speed of the leading vehicle and the location of the leading vehicle, to the intent that the following vehicle computes the required speed upon reaching the instant location of the lead vehicle.
